Abstract
In his third encyclical letter, Caritas in Veritate, Pope Benedict XVI discusses the social issue using as a criterion the values of love and truth that configure man's essence and vocation to happiness and brotherhood within the large human family. To that end the Pope calls for a new interdisciplinary dialogue, while promoting a society that rediscovers the importance of love and the centrality of the person to God. These values can promote an integral development. If the power of love has its origin in God, Eternal Love, and Absolute Truth, it can also be explained rationally. In this study, the author gathers and comments on the admonitions of the encyclical about the need to promote an interdisciplinary dialogue to ensure that science and technology contribute to the promotion of ethical values that have to protect the dignity of the human person.
